La Paz Embraces Electronic Tolls: Drivers Hail Efficiency of Telepeaje System La Paz, Bolivia – The implementation of the Telepeaje electronic toll system in La Paz is proving to be a success, according to a recent report by Bolivia TV. The system, designed to streamline toll payments, has been met with positive feedback from drivers who say it significantly reduces wait times, especially during peak hours. "It's a great benefit, especially when there are traffic jams," said one driver interviewed in the report. "We get out of line and go straight through." The video report shows vehicles smoothly passing through the Telepeaje lanes, contrasting with the potential for long queues at traditional toll booths. Another driver added, "It's convenient when there are traffic jams; you pass directly through."
